Type of Group Activities/Need for Decisions Organizational Form Membership Requirements
Support group Ideas and feelings shared, no critical Loose discussion, no designated facilitator May be open or restricted to those decisions who are safe for other participants Discussion group Ideas and information shared, no Loose discussion, participants may try to persuade each Usually open critical decisions other to a particular perspective, but don’t need to Lectures, workshops Presentation by knowledgeable or Very structured agenda, designated presenter/facilitator Usually open skilled person to less-knowledgeable or less-skilled, no critical decisions Individual working on Individual takes own initiative to do whatever she/he her/his own — wants; individual is not restricted unless she/he — infringes on others Individual (or small Day-to-day tasks, many non-critical Decisions are (1) left to individual’s discretion, (2) Supervisor or steering group task group) working on decisions dictated by a supervisor (who interprets the group’s selects; payment may be made for behalf of a larger group mandate), or (3) obvious from steering group’s mandate satisfactory work Task group Tasks to reach a goal, important Consensus of group, cooperative facilitation Restricted to those willing to work decisions — everyone’s input needed, with group and who have skills of careful deliberation necessary cooperative decision-making Federation, alliance of Tasks to reach a goal, decisions Consent of each group to federation decisions, Restricted to those willing to work groups with similar restricted to areas where groups are cooperative facilitation with other groups and who have values and goals trying to work together skills of cooperative decision- making Coalition of groups Tasks to reach a goal, decisions Minimal consent of each group to coalition decisions, Restricted to those groups useful with diverse values and restricted to areas where groups are may require strong facilitation and structured, rule- for coalition purposes goals trying to work together based decision-making process Network Communication among dispersed Loose discussion, participants may try to persuade each Usually open individuals or groups, no critical other to a particular perspective, but don’t need to decisions Large, dispersed task Tasks to reach a goal, decisions must Hierarchical organization with strict authority, decisions Very restricted and chosen by those group that must be coordinated made by those at the top and passed down, sanctions at the top; payment probably coordinate many imposed against those who disobey required for compliance activities Prepared by Randy Schutt, P.O.
